“Mr. Conner, since you’ve already said you’re not feeling well and want to go home to rest, we won’t force you to stay.” Wynette smiled gently as she spoke.

After a slight pause, she continued, “Thank you for your contributions to the Shepherd Group over the past three years. We’ll have the finance department settle your salary according to the contract.

“Also, there’s 50 thousand in this card. Consider it a small token from my mother and me. I hope you’ll recover soon.” Wynette took out a card that didn’t require a password and placed it in front of him.

Her meaning was very clear. She was giving him a graceful exit based on his own words.

Liam hadn’t expected that what he casually used as a threat would be turned around and used against him.

He was completely at a loss for words now, not knowing how to refute her decision.

It felt like he had shot himself in the foot. It was so damn suffocating.

Inside, Liam had already cursed Wynette countless times.

He shifted his gaze to Kaylee. “Mrs. Jewell, is this your decision as well?”

Kaylee was now on the same side as Wynette.

She nodded. “Just like Wynette said, you’ve worked hard all these years. But now Wynette has grown up. Jewell Group is her responsibility, and she should take it over.”

Liam sneered. “I see you’re clearly discarding me after I’ve served my purpose. Mrs. Jewell, you can’t act without conscience. I’ve contributed plenty to this company. And now you just want to send me away like this? It’s not happening.

Wynette looked as if she had already anticipated his shameless act.

She just looked at him calmly and said, “Mr. Conner, I originally wanted to let you leave with dignity out of respect for everything you’ve done for Jewell Group over the years. A peaceful ending would’ve been better for everyone.

“But since you don’t want that, don’t blame me for tearing things apart.”

With that, Wynette glanced at Shirley standing behind him. “Shirley.”

Liam’s heart tightened. What was she calling Shirley for?

Very quickly, Shirley’s actions gave him the answer.

Liam, who had just been sitting back with his legs crossed and acting shameless, suddenly went limp. The arrogance from moments ago disappeared without a trace.

He looked up in shock. “You… Shirley is your underling?”

Shirley had been hired into Jewell Group three months ago by Liam himself.

He had thought he was cultivating one of his own people.

He never expected Wynette to have already made arrangements.

While he was still feeling smug, he had no idea that Wynette had already placed someone by his side long ago, quietly waiting for the right moment.

Wynette looked at his drastically changed expression and let out a soft laugh. “Aren’t you the same? You were sent here by Justin, weren’t you?”

She had only found out three months ago that Liam was someone funded by Justin.

Liam came from the countryside. His parents had died early, and he grew up with his blind grandmother. Later, he got into college, but he almost dropped out due to poverty.

By chance, he saved Justin and received financial support from him.

Even his overseas studies were funded by the Shepherds.

Liam rarely interacted with the Shepherds, so few people knew that the one who had supported him back then was Justin, who was a few years older than him.

“So you already knew,” Liam said, quickly regaining his composure.

He hadn’t deliberately hidden that, but it still shouldn’t have been exposed so easily.
